Are you passionate about organisational risk and risk governance, insurance portfolio management and fostering a positive risk culture?
Broken Hill City Council is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Enterprise Risk Coordinator to join our Enterprise Risk and Workplace Health & Safety team.
This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to the continued growth and maturity of Council's risk management capability while supporting a positive, proactive risk culture across the organisation.
Reporting to the Manager Enterprise Risk, this position plays a key role in the ongoing development, coordination, monitoring and continuous improvement of Council's Enterprise Risk Management Framework (ERM) and Workplace Health and Safety (WHS) Management systems.
Job Description
You will support a diverse portfolio of responsibilities, including:
Coordinating and maintaining Council's Enterprise Risk Management Framework, risk registers, and governance reporting processes.
Supporting the management of the Council's insurance portfolio, including claims coordination, renewals, and risk improvement initiatives.
Coordinating policy development, reviews, and governance documentation.
Maintaining delegated systems, databases, and registers to ensure accurate and timely risk information.
Supporting continuous improvement initiatives that enhance organisational resilience, compliance, and service delivery.
Providing trusted advice and customer-focused support to internal stakeholders across the Council.
